Home

selfhosted

Selfhosted refers to the practice of hosting and managing software applications, services, or platforms independently on one's own infrastructure or hardware, rather than relying on third-party cloud providers or external hosting services. This approach allows individuals or organizations to maintain full control over their data, configurations, and security settings.

Selfhosting is commonly used for websites, email servers, collaboration tools, media servers, content management systems, and

Advantages of selfhosting include increased data privacy, improved security control, and greater flexibility to modify and

Typical selfhosting solutions utilize open-source software and tools, allowing for transparent modifications and community-supported customization. Popular

Overall, selfhosting empowers users with autonomy over their digital environment but demands sufficient technical skill and

Would you like more detailed information on specific selfhosting applications or best practices?

other
digital
services.
By
choosing
to
selfhost,
users
can
customize
and
optimize
the
environment
to
meet
specific
needs,
enhance
privacy,
and
reduce
dependency
on
external
providers.
However,
it
also
requires
technical
expertise
to
set
up,
maintain,
and
troubleshoot
systems.
extend
functionality.
It
can
also
be
cost-effective
for
long-term
use,
especially
when
large
volumes
of
data
or
custom
integrations
are
needed.
Conversely,
selfhosting
involves
responsibilities
such
as
hardware
management,
software
updates,
backups,
and
cybersecurity
defenses.
selfhosted
applications
include
Nextcloud
for
file
sharing,
Mastodon
for
social
networking,
and
Home
Assistant
for
smart
home
management.
resources.
Its
popularity
continues
to
grow,
especially
among
privacy-conscious
users
and
organizations
seeking
tailored
or
independent
operations.